Malian Soldiers Killed in Ambush
A joint Malian army and Russia's Africa Corps military convoy was ambushed, resulting in the deaths of at least 50 Malian soldiers. The attack occurred on an unspecified date, highlighting ongoing security challenges in the region. Details regarding the perpetrators of the ambush and the specific location remain undisclosed in initial reports.
This incident underscores the volatile security situation in Mali, where government forces and their allies, including foreign military personnel, continue to face threats from various armed groups. The presence of Russia's Africa Corps alongside Malian troops suggests a deepening security cooperation between the two nations. The Africa Corps is a unit associated with Russia's military operations in Africa, often involved in training and security support.
The ambush is one of the deadliest attacks on Malian security forces in recent memory, raising concerns about the effectiveness of counter-terrorism strategies and the overall stability of the country.
